Output 2522d77835827e5c027efe78b0bca511282a0f04c1f4bcc02d8ebc0858144061:1

value
345632919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8effffcf16b63096fa32d4b66d1817a6237e1f6 OP_EQUAL
address
3NvgCY8SYTXJSK72qoCcLRZUaULR1tJgdZ
transaction
2522d77835827e5c027efe78b0bca511282a0f04c1f4bcc02d8ebc0858144061
confirmations
245962
spent
true